International Account Director

Our client is an Omnichannel Ad Tech business that has a phenomenal reputation within the industry. They have their own proprietary brand safety / contextual tech and are about to embark on the next part of their growth journey, and this is your chance to join a trusted, credible and rapidly growing business in the superhot space. They are agile and able to deliver custom solutions for advertisers.

As a business developer, you are responsible for building partnerships with new or existing advertisers. You will be responsible for creating new and custom proposals, building relationships across all levels and growing the business with the global/International teams of the 'big six' London agencies (Publicis, Omnicom, Dentsu, etc. You will be reporting to the Head of International and jointly working on strategic planning and growth.

Responsibilities

  • Understanding and communicating the company’s products and how they will assist clients in reaching their marketing goals
  • Identify and qualify opportunities leveraging your own creativity, inbound lead flow, personal prospecting efforts, contacts, existing accounts and partners.
  • Approach the role with a growth-oriented, learning, entrepreneurial mindset.
  • Managing International campaigns with local sales and CSM teams from start to finish. Including overarching contracts, strategy, brief response, media plan creation, execution, reporting and invoicing

Requirements

  • 4+ years of proven hands-on experience at an Adtech company, publisher, digital media companies or digital media agency
  • A strong network of International contacts ideally across Publicis, Omnicom, Dentsu, IPG or Havas
  • Have strong communication skills; verbal, written, interpersonal and (group) presentation
  • Thrive as a presenter and be passionate about sales
  • Client facing experience working with the 'big six' advertising agencies - International/Global teams
  • Able to help develop and set best practices and help train other team members to stay competitive in an ever-changing digital landscape
Company
YOUSEEK
Location
London, UK
Posted
Company
YOUSEEK
Location
London, UK
Posted